AN ENGLISH ENGRAVED PEARWOOD GOBLET
LATE 16TH CENTURY
The bowl with scratch carved, cross hatched decoration, disc knop and ring turned stem
6½.in. (16½.cm) high

Lot Essay

For similar goblets with comparable engraved decoration see Treen for the Table by Jonathan Levi, p.47 & 50, and for a posset-service Oak furniture, the British Tradition by Victor Chinnery, p. 83
